How long was Army basic training in 1950?

There was an orderly room across the “company street” and a supply room nearby. The training day was 5 a.m. to 10 p.m., and could be longer if one got “kitchen police” or furnace detail. Since the training was arduous, most of us were sleep-deprived for the entire eight weeks.

What percentage of military officers drop out of basic training?

The Navy, Army, and Marines have recruits drop out at roughly the same rate, as each other, between 11 and 14 percent annually. Contrary to what many think, the goal of officers in basic training isn’t just to push recruits to drop out.

What happens after basic training in the Army?

After you graduate from basic training, you will undergo two additional phases of training, known as Advanced Individual Training, where you will learn the job skills required of your MOS. Your first introduction to the Army experience will come from your Drill Sergeants.

How long does it take to become a US Army soldier?

the ten-week journey from civilian to soldier. Basic Combat Training (BCT) is a training course that transforms civilians into Soldiers. Over the course of ten weeks, recruits will learn basic tactical and survival skills along with how to shoot, rappel, and march.

How many points are needed to pass Army basic training?

A minimum of 180 points is required to pass U.S. Army Basic Training. Those who pass will move on to “Bivouac” (camping) and FTX ( Field Training Exercises ), such as nighttime combat operations and MOUT (Military Operations in Urban Terrain) training.
